Output 2ecb5c29a8a09f46132c7016df045c2a1e4989819172be76e718e427aa560639:0

value
931439909
script pubkey
OP_0 OP_PUSHBYTES_20 8c2b5bd650ab1269f353c68aa2e6b28deef8b404
address
bc1q3s44h4js4vfxnu6nc6929e4j3hh03dqy6pwuu4
transaction
2ecb5c29a8a09f46132c7016df045c2a1e4989819172be76e718e427aa560639
spent
true